Wilkes Men's Volleyball Drops Home Tri-Match Against Kean University and Hartwick College
WILKES-BARRE, Pa. – The Wilkes men's volleyball team dropped both matches of its home tri-match Saturday evening, falling to Kean University and Hartwick College.
With the results, Wilkes moves to 6-9 overall and 0-1 in Continental Volleyball Conference (CVC) play. Kean improves to 8-4 overall and 1-0 in conference action, while Hartwick shifts to 3-9 on the season.
Game 1: Kean 3, Wilkes 1
The opening two sets went to Kean by identical 25-21 scores. The Cougars were highly efficient offensively, combining to hit .516 across the first two frames, while Wilkes posted a .209 hitting percentage during that stretch.
Wilkes responded in the third set, racing out to a 13-6 advantage and maintaining control throughout much of the frame. Kean mounted a 6-0 run to trim the deficit to three, but the Colonels held steady to secure their first set win, 25-22. Offensively, Wilkes found its rhythm, hitting .423 with 14 kills while limiting Kean to a .250 on 12 kills.
Wilkes carried early momentum into the fourth set, building a 5-3 lead before Kean responded with a decisive 9-2 run to seize control. The Cougars maintained the advantage the rest of the way, closing out the set 25-18 to secure the 3-1 match victory.

Game 2: Hartwick 3, Wilkes 2
In the final match of the day, Wilkes dropped the opening two sets to Hartwick by scores of 25-20 and 25-22. Over those frames, the Hawks were highly efficient offensively, combining for a .403 hitting percentage, while the Colonels struggled to find their rhythm and posted a -.020 clip.
Refusing to go quietly, the Colonels found their rhythm in the third and fourth sets, claiming them 25-21 and 25-11, respectively. Wilkes' offense came alive, hitting .324 in the third and .355 in the fourth while combining for 28 kills across the two frames to force a decisive fifth set.
Both teams exchanged points through the opening 13 rallies of the decisive set, but it was the Hawks who capitalized late, scoring the final two points to claim the set 15-13 and secure the match victory.
